Answer:
The data speed 1.4Mbps is in the 34th percentile.
Step-by-step explanation:
To find the percentile of a value X in a data set, we divide the number of values lesser than X in the data set by the total number of values in the data set, and then multiply by 100.
In this set
There are 17 values lesser than 1.4
There are 50 values in all.
So

The data speed 1.4Mbps is in the 34th percentile.

Answer: 7 units</h3>
============================================================
Explanation:
r = distance from the origin (0,0) to a point on the polar curve
To find the length of the flower petal, we need to max out r (i.e. get it as large as possible).
Recall that sin(x) maxes out at 1, so that also applies to sin(2θ) as well.
Therefore, r = 7*sin(2θ) maxes out at r = 7*1 = 7 and this is the length of each petal. Basically it's the number out front of the sine term.
